Factors to Consider When Installing Windows


Before proceeding with window installation, house owners must think about a number of factors:

  1. Budget: Determine how much you are prepared to invest on window installation and focus on the functions that matter the majority of.

  2. Styles and Aesthetics: Choose window designs that complement the design of your home while addressing your particular needs.

  3. Climate: Considering local climate conditions can inform your option of products and types of windows.

  4. Installation Time: Some kinds of windows need longer installation durations. Examine how this may impact your everyday regimen.

  5. Regulatory Compliance: Check local building codes, as there might be policies regarding window installation.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)


What is the average cost of window installation?

The average cost of window installation in the United States can vary from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window, depending upon the products, type, and installation complexities.

How long does the installation procedure take?

Most window installations can be finished in a day; nevertheless, bigger projects may take longer due to the number of windows and particular styles.

How can I keep my new windows?

Routine maintenance includes cleaning up the glass, examining seals, and guaranteeing that moving parts operate efficiently. For wooden frames, routine painting or staining is needed.

Are energy-efficient windows worth the financial investment?

Yes, while they may have a greater in advance cost, energy-efficient windows can cause considerable cost savings on energy bills and increased convenience.

Can I install windows myself?

While DIY installation is possible, it is extremely advised to work with a professional to guarantee proper fitting and compliance with local structure codes.
